WET FELTED FINGERLESS MITTS -  Instructor Kara Perpelitz, SpinHeartSpin Handspun Yarns and Fibre Arts

$80.00

Saturday, September 6th, 1-4pm (3hrs) $80

Wool is such a wonderful insulator, keeping you warm in the winter and cool in the summer. Fingerless mitts can be worn year round, and are an amazing fashion statement! In this workshop students will learn how to calculate for shrinkage, use a resist, avoid obvious seams, and incorporate fun fibre additions to their felted piece.

Ages 16+

Students Bring to Class: 4oz/100grams of merino wool top (NOT SUPERWASH), sharp scissors, and a towel.

Price Breakdown: $8 Materials fee includes printouts, resist material and fibre additions (silk fabric bits, silk noils, pulled sari silk and more!), $72 registration fee

Kara Perpelitz is a Master Spinner (2017) and Fibre Artist who has lived in some part of Saskatchewan her entire life. When she first discovered hand spun yarns over 15 years ago, she certainly didn’t see it becoming a passion. This passion has led to writing, teaching, and creating art out of yarn. This passion for yarn lead to passion for fibre work in general. She explores the concept of place and connection through fibre arts, using manipulations such as spinning yarn, felting, dyeing, printing, sewing and more.
